Look, if you're a first-time Bangkok visitor and you love shopping, just stay in Siam. It's that simple. You've got Siam Paragon, CentralWorld, Siam Center, MBK, and the whole Siam Square street fashion zone within a 10-minute walk. BTS Siam is also the line interchange, so getting anywhere else in the city is a non-issue. All 11 hotels here sit within a 5–7 minute walk of Siam BTS, ranging from hostels at ฿350/night up to Siam Kempinski at ฿8,000+. Every one of them is rated 8.0+ by real guests, all have solid Wi-Fi and English-speaking staff. Whether you want a splurge with a tropical garden pool, a slick mid-range design hotel, or a backpacker dorm steps from Siam Square — it's all on the list.

No. 1 #1 luxury hotel · wall-to-wall with Siam Paragon ★9.4 Siam Kempinski Hotel Bangkok
📍 Siam district, sharing a wall with Siam Paragon and about 200 metres from BTS Siam; CentralWorld is roughly 600 metres away and the Erawan Shrine a 10-minute walk.
We open the Siam list with the address everyone here is quietly compared against: Siam Kempinski Hotel Bangkok, the most decorated 5-star in the district. The number that explains it is 200 metres — that is roughly the walk to BTS Siam, and the hotel literally shares a wall with Siam Paragon, so you reach the mall, the food hall and the IMAX without crossing a single road. Inside, the noise of central Bangkok drops away into a tropical garden built around a winding lagoon pool, with the ground-floor Deluxe Lagoon rooms opening straight onto the water. Real guests rate it around 9.4 to 9.6, it took a Top Choice Award in 2016, and rooms run from roughly $230 a night up past $700 for the bigger suites. We recommend it without hedging for couples and anyone who wants genuine luxury that is still a two-minute walk from the best shopping in the city.
- Shares a wall with Siam Paragon — no road crossing to shops or food hall
- Ground-floor Deluxe Lagoon rooms open straight onto a 50-metre garden pool
- About 200 metres to BTS Siam, the city's main interchange
- Highest entry price on this list, from about $230 a night
- Streets around Siam choke at rush hour, so plan taxis around it

No. 2 #2 4-star hotel · the only one inside Siam Square ★8.9 Novotel Bangkok on Siam Square
📍 Right inside Siam Square, 2 minutes on foot to Siam Center and about 200 metres to BTS Siam
Here is the line that sets Novotel Bangkok on Siam Square apart from every other hotel in this guide: it is the only 4-star property built directly inside Siam Square itself, not a block away. Walk out the lobby and you are immediately among the shops, food stalls and malls that make this Bangkok's busiest shopping district. It is a 2-minute walk to Siam Center, 5 minutes to Siam Paragon, and roughly 200 metres to BTS Siam, the interchange station that connects both Skytrain lines. The 32-square-metre Superior rooms were recently renovated in a modern grey-brown-and-wood scheme, with a choice of 4 pillow types and Wi-Fi that clears 100 Mbps. Facilities cover a 9th-floor pool, a gym, a small indoor playground and a spa. Real guests score it around 8.9/10, and rates start near $100 a night. Best for shoppers and families who want to step out the door straight into the action.
- Only 4-star inside Siam Square
- 2 minutes on foot to Siam Center
- Renovated 32 sqm rooms
- Siam Square crowds never let up
- Pool is small for a 4-star

No. 3 #3 Luxury 5-star hotel · on top of CentralWorld mall ★9.3 Centara Grand at CentralWorld
📍 On top of CentralWorld mall in the Ratchaprasong district, a 5-minute covered walk from BTS Chit Lom and Siam, with the Erawan Shrine and Big C Ratchadamri at the doorstep.
Our #3 pick is the rare luxury hotel that occupies floors 23 to 55 above the largest shopping mall in Thailand: Centara Grand at CentralWorld. It sits in the Ratchaprasong district about a 5-minute covered walk from BTS Chit Lom and Siam, and the real draw is access — step out of the lift on the ground floor and you are inside CentralWorld, eight levels with 100+ restaurants, ZARA, UNIQLO and a Sephora Beauty Hall. The rooms open onto big-glass city views, and the Red Sky open-air rooftop restaurant on floor 55 is about as romantic as Bangkok dining gets. Real guest scores land around 9.3 to 9.4, rates start near $140 a night, and the plaza out front is the country's biggest New Year Countdown stage. We send couples and shopping-minded families here when they want a polished tower stay where everything is under one roof.
- Sits on top of CentralWorld, 100+ restaurants under one roof
- Floor-to-ceiling city views, rated 9.5 by guests
- Red Sky open-air rooftop bar on floor 55
- Ratchaprasong streets gridlock at rush hour
- Rooms sell out weeks ahead around New Year Countdown

No. 4 #4 loft-style hotel · pool and design under $60 a night ★9 Happy 3
📍 In a quiet Pathumwan lane about 400 metres from BTS National Stadium and 350 metres from MBK Center
Here is the number that explains Happy 3: rooms start near $50 a night, yet the place reads like a $140 boutique. This is the genuine hidden hotel of the Siam list — a small, 3-star, apartment-style building dressed in stripped-back industrial loft style, the kind most casual visitors walk right past while travelers in the know book it months out. The 28-square-metre Loft Deluxe rooms run on polished concrete, 3-metre ceilings and exposed ductwork, and there is a real rooftop pool — roughly 8 metres of clear water with timber decking, rare at this price. It sits about 400 metres from BTS National Stadium and 350 metres from MBK Center, in a Chulalongkorn University lane where a street-food plate costs $2. Real guests score it around 9.0 to 9.1, with value rated 9.4. Best for design-minded travelers on a budget who still want a pool.
- Polished-concrete loft rooms, 3m ceilings
- Real rooftop pool from about $50
- Guest score 9.0-9.1, value rated 9.4
- Small hotel, very few rooms
- BTS is a 400-metre walk, not at the door

No. 5 #5 Luxury 5-star · attached to MBK Center ★9.3 Pathumwan Princess Hotel
📍 Pathumwan, physically attached to MBK Center and about 500 m from BTS Siam; Jim Thompson House is a 10-minute, 700 m walk away.
The reason to pick Pathumwan Princess Hotel over its glossier neighbours is the covered Skywalk: it runs from BTS National Stadium through MBK Center and straight into the lobby, so you can shop, eat and check in without ever stepping into Bangkok's heat or rain. This is a classic 5-star that has held its quality — a high-ceilinged lobby under a big crystal chandelier, 38 sq m Deluxe rooms that run larger than the area average, and city views toward Chulalongkorn University's green campus. The standout is what sits upstairs: a 20-metre pool on the 8th floor, a gym with a window-side running track, and two full-size outdoor tennis courts on the 11th — genuinely rare in central Bangkok. Real guests score it around 9.3 to 9.4, and rooms start near $100 a night. We'd send families shopping MBK and morning-sport types here.
- Covered Skywalk into MBK and BTS — no street, no heat
- 38 sq m Deluxe rooms with clear Chula campus views
- Two outdoor tennis courts plus a 20 m pool
- Pathumwan streets clog at rush hour
- Cream-and-gold decor reads dated next to newer towers

No. 6 #6 4-star hotel · next to BTS National Stadium ★8.9 Mercure Bangkok Siam
📍 Pathumwan, directly beside BTS National Stadium, with MBK Center one Rama 1 Road crossing away and Siam Square about 600 metres on foot.
Ranked #6 for being almost absurdly convenient, Mercure Bangkok Siam is a right-sized 4-star you spot from the train: a tall dark-grey marble facade that stands out against the usual white blocks. The pull here is the location. The hotel sits directly beside BTS National Stadium, and MBK Center is one road crossing away across Rama 1. Rooms are sensibly sized — the 24 sqm Superior is not large but uses every inch — with modern brown-and-gold styling and a glass rain-shower bathroom. Real guests score it around 8.9 to 9.0, and rates open near $57 a night and run to roughly $108 for the bigger rooms. We'd send anyone here who wants a train-side base for shopping and sightseeing without paying Siam Paragon prices — you spend the savings on food and retail instead.
- About 50 m from BTS National Stadium — roll your bag to the lobby in a minute
- MBK Center is one Rama 1 Road crossing away, Siam Square 600 m on foot
- Rates open near $57, with modern rooms and a rooftop pool
- The 24 sqm Superior is sensibly sized but runs small for the price
- Busy Pathumwan address with BTS trains passing at eye level

No. 7 #7 3-star hotel · ibis-chain value steps from BTS National Stadium ★8.7 ibis Bangkok Siam
📍 Pathum Wan district, right at BTS National Stadium, with a 5-minute Skywalk to MBK Center and Siam Square
Here is the line that makes ibis Bangkok Siam the easy pick for value in this district: it is a Top Choice Award 2016 winner that sits directly at BTS National Stadium, with a covered Skywalk running you into MBK Center in about 5 minutes without ever stepping into the heat. The 20-square-metre rooms keep things tidy and Scandinavian — pale wood headboard, white duvet, the firm Sweet Bed by ibis mattress and a small work desk with a universal socket. Downstairs, The Square restaurant runs 24 hours with Thai and Western mains around $6 to $11, and the front desk is famous for clearing late, delayed-flight arrivals fast. Real guests score it around 8.7/10, with value rated 9.2, and rates start near $57. Best for solo travellers, business trips and budget-minded explorers who want a reliable chain hotel and no surprises.
- Top Choice Award 2016 winner
- Steps from BTS National Stadium
- 24-hour desk and fast check-in
- Plain business-style rooms
- Gym is just 2 treadmills and 1 bike

No. 8 #8 4-star design hotel · panoramic city views by BTS National Stadium ★8.7 Holiday Inn Express Bangkok Siam
📍 Pathum Wan district, right next to BTS National Stadium, a 5-minute Skywalk to MBK and Siam Square
Holiday Inn Express Bangkok Siam is a 4-star IHG hotel built tall and slim, which is the trade-off that defines it: rooms run a compact 22 sq m, but the 2.5-metre floor-to-ceiling windows hand you a panoramic city view most pricier hotels charge a premium for. From an 18th-floor standard room you look straight at MBK and CentralWorld, with the spire of King Power Mahanakhon off in the distance. The interior leans dark tones cut with bright pops and blue-orange sky photography, and it works. The 6th-floor lobby runs a genuinely fast Express check-in. You are right beside BTS National Stadium, a 5-minute covered Skywalk to MBK and Siam Square. Real guests score it around 8.7, view alone pulls a 9.0, and rooms start near $63 a night. Best for travelers who want sharp design and a high-floor view without the luxury price tag.
- Striking slim 2017 tower, black-green with pie-slice corners
- 2.5 m floor-to-ceiling windows, 180-degree city view
- Steps from BTS National Stadium, 5 min walk to MBK
- Rooms are a compact 22 sq m
- Facilities are basic, no pool or full restaurant

No. 9 #9 boutique hotel · Thai design that out-scores 4 and 5-star towers ★9.2 Nine Design Place
📍 Pathum Wan district on a small soi, about 350 metres from MBK Center and 450 metres from BTS National Stadium; Jim Thompson House is a 10-minute walk away.
This is the entry on the Siam list that looks like a typo until you read the reviews twice: a 3-star boutique called Nine Design Place rates around 9.2 to 9.4 from real guests, which is higher than several 4 and 5-star towers a few streets over. It is small — a quiet, owner-run hotel rather than a chain — and the pull is the decor, with Thai craft worked into every corner from the front desk to the room: carved teak, hand-woven silk, brass Buddha figures on polished stone. The walk to MBK Center and the BTS is under 5 minutes, threading past the Chulalongkorn University street-food stalls on the way. Rooms open around $57 a night and top out near $100. We recommend it for couples, solo travellers and anyone chasing a real local stay who would rather have warm service and design character than a big anonymous lobby.
- Rates around 9.2 to 9.4, above several nearby 4 and 5-star hotels
- Carved teak, hand-woven silk and brass Buddhas in every room and the lobby
- About a 5-minute walk to both MBK Center and BTS National Stadium
- Small hotel with very few rooms, so it sells out weeks ahead
- No pool, gym or spa — facilities stay basic

No. 10 #10 Design hostel · cheapest stay in Siam Square ★9 Lub d Bangkok Siam
📍 Dead-centre Siam: about 100 m from BTS National Stadium, 400 m from MBK Center, and a 10-minute walk to Siam Paragon.
Our #10 pick is the one for backpackers and budget travelers — Lub d Bangkok Siam, a 9-storey hostel painted bright yellow and covered in street-art graffiti about 100 metres from BTS National Stadium. It mixes hostel, hotel and backpacker energy better than almost anywhere in the city: you get private rooms and 4-to-8-bed dorms, so a group of four can take a private dorm for cheap, while couples get a Private Double with an ensuite. Rooms run on bright colour-blocked walls and white beds — built for people who plan to be out all day. Real guests score it 9.0–9.2, dorm beds start around $10, and a twin private runs roughly $34. We'd send solo travelers, three-or-four-person friend groups and anyone counting their cash straight here.
- Design hostel 100 m from BTS National Stadium
- Private rooms and 4-8-bed dorms under one roof
- Cheapest pick on the list, beds from ~$10
- Hostel-grade facilities, not a full-service hotel
- Dorm bathrooms are down the hall, not ensuite

No. 11 #11 Guesthouse · home-like rooms a 5-minute walk from MBK ★8.7 Patumwan House
📍 Pathumwan district, on a quiet lane 350 metres from MBK and 500 metres from BTS National Stadium
Closing out the Siam list is the warmest pick of the bunch: Patumwan House, a 3-star guesthouse that reads more like a well-kept family home than a hotel. Travelers keep coming back for two reasons — a location 350 metres from MBK, and interiors that earn the name. Rooms sit on polished herringbone parquet with real teak furniture, and the whole place has the hush of someone's house rather than a lobby. If you get homesick on the road, this is the antidote. You're a 5-minute walk from MBK, 500 metres from BTS National Stadium, and a short stroll from Siam Square and Siam Paragon. Real guests score it around 8.7–8.8, rooms start near $39 a night, and the owner does the welcoming herself. We send people here when they want a homey, genuinely affordable base in the middle of Bangkok's shopping core.
- Polished herringbone parquet and real teak furniture throughout
- Owner-run welcome — staff remember your name by day two
- 350 metres to MBK, rooms from about $39
- Small property — only a handful of rooms
- No pool, gym, or restaurant beyond breakfast

📊Comparison · all 11 hotels
| # | Hotel | Stars | Score | From / night | Area | Highlight |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Siam Kempinski Hotel Bangkok | 5 | 9.4 | ฿8,000 | About 200 metres to BTS Siam, two stops from the airport rail link interchange at Phaya Thai; shares a wall with Siam Paragon. | #1 luxury hotel · wall-to-wall with Siam Paragon |
| 2 | Novotel Bangkok on Siam Square | 4 | 8.9 | ฿3,500 | About 200 metres to BTS Siam interchange; roughly 45-60 minutes by taxi to Suvarnabhumi Airport | #2 4-star hotel · the only one inside Siam Square |
| 3 | Centara Grand at CentralWorld | 5 | 9.3 | ฿5,000 | About 500 m to BTS Chit Lom and Siam, both covered walks; roughly 45-60 minutes by car to Suvarnabhumi Airport in normal traffic. | #3 Luxury 5-star hotel · on top of CentralWorld mall |
| 4 | Happy 3 | 3 | 9.0 | ฿1,800 | About 400 metres on foot to BTS National Stadium; roughly 45-60 minutes by taxi to Suvarnabhumi Airport | #4 loft-style hotel · pool and design under $60 a night |
| 5 | Pathumwan Princess Hotel | 5 | 9.3 | ฿3,500 | About 500 m to BTS Siam on foot, or skip the street entirely via the covered Skywalk from BTS National Stadium straight into the lobby. | #5 Luxury 5-star · attached to MBK Center |
| 6 | Mercure Bangkok Siam | 4 | 8.9 | ฿2,000 | Right next to BTS National Stadium (about 50 m to the lobby door); cross Rama 1 Road to reach MBK Center in under 3 minutes. | #6 4-star hotel · next to BTS National Stadium |
| 7 | ibis Bangkok Siam | 3 | 8.7 | ฿2,000 | Steps from BTS National Stadium, a 5-minute covered walk to MBK; roughly 45-60 minutes by taxi to Suvarnabhumi Airport | #7 3-star hotel · ibis-chain value steps from BTS National Stadium |
| 8 | Holiday Inn Express Bangkok Siam | 4 | 8.7 | ฿2,200 | Next to BTS National Stadium | #8 4-star design hotel · panoramic city views by BTS National Stadium |
| 9 | Nine Design Place | 3 | 9.2 | ฿2,000 | About 450 metres to BTS National Stadium and 350 metres to MBK Center, both a 5-minute walk; one rail interchange from the airport link at Phaya Thai. | #9 boutique hotel · Thai design that out-scores 4 and 5-star towers |
| 10 | Lub d Bangkok Siam | 2 | 9.0 | ฿350 | About 100 m to BTS National Stadium; one stop to the Banthat Thong street-food strip and a 30-min ride to Suvarnabhumi Airport. | #10 Design hostel · cheapest stay in Siam Square |
| 11 | Patumwan House | 3 | 8.7 | ฿1,350 | 5-minute walk (350 metres) to MBK; 500 metres to BTS National Stadium; about 30 km from Suvarnabhumi Airport | #11 Guesthouse · home-like rooms a 5-minute walk from MBK |
